The Escherichia coli H-NS protein is a nucleoid-associated protein involved
in gene regulation and DNA compaction. To get more insight into the mechan
ism:of DNA compaction we applied atomic force microscopy (AFM) to study the
structure of H-NS-DNA complexes. On circular DNA molecules two different l
evels of H-NS induced condensation were observed. H-MS:induced lateral cond
ensation of large regions of the:plasmid. In addition, large globular struc
tures were identified that incorporated a considerable amount of DNA. The f
ormation of these globular structures appeared not to be dependent on any S
pecific sequence, On the basis of the AFM images, a model for global conden
sation of the chromosomal DNA by H-NS is proposed.
